Flash Welding Forming Method of Cobalt-Based Superalloy Large Section Rings
A high-temperature alloy, large-section technology, used in welding equipment, welding power sources, resistance welding equipment, etc., can solve the problems of welding quality influence, discontinuity, unstable temperature field, etc., and achieve a reasonable temperature field and stable preheating process. [0031] The main chemical element content (percentage by weight) of the alloy is: 0.05% to 0.15% of C content, 20.0% to 24.0% of Cr content, 20.0% to 24.0% of Ni content, 13.0% to 16.0% of W content, 13.0% to 16.0% of W content, La content 0.03% ~ 0.12%, Si content 0.20% ~ 0.50%, Fe content ≤ 0.30%, B content ≤ 0.015%, Mn content ≤ 1.25%, P content ≤ 0.020%, S content ≤ 0.015 %, containing Ag ≤ 0.0010%, containing Bi ≤ 0.0001%, containing Pb ≤ 0.0010%, containing Cu ≤ 0.07%, and the balance being Co.
[0032] The flash welding forming process steps of the alloy large cross-section ring are as follows:
[0033] Step 1: Preheat.
